Furfuryl Pentanoate Market Overview
Global Furfuryl Pentanoate Market size is projected at USD 9.69 million in 2026 and is expected to hit USD 11.31 million by 2035 with a CAGR of 2.5%.
The Furfuryl Pentanoate market is expanding due to its increasing application in flavor and fragrance industries, where synthetic esters contribute nearly 63% of total flavoring agents globally.
